Electronic structure and magnetic properties of3dimpurities in ferromagnetic metals

Abstract
The electronic structure of 3d impurities (from Ti to Ni) in ferromagnetic metals (bcc and fcc Fe, hcp and fcc Co, fcc Ni) is calculated by the linear-muffin-tin-orbital Green’s-function method. The values of local magnetic moments and effective exchange parameters are listed. For Mn impurities in bcc Fe and hcp Co, two possible impurity configurations with different spin direction are found. Based on the analysis of effective exchange parameters, the relative stability of different configurations is discussed.
